Jackson Eshbaugh’s Reviews > Writing a C Compiler: Build a Real Programming Language from Scratch > Status Update

Jackson Eshbaugh
Jackson Eshbaugh is on page 10 of 750
Just started reading today. I love it already. I began work on my compiler and have finished my implementation of the simple lexer. Next up, the parser!
Jun 29, 2025 08:33PM
Writing a C Compiler: Build a Real Programming Language from Scratch

flag

Jackson’s Previous Updates

Jackson Eshbaugh
Jackson Eshbaugh is on page 39 of 750
Implemented TACKY, but not the other passes in assembly generation.
Jul 07, 2025 07:18PM
Writing a C Compiler: Build a Real Programming Language from Scratch


Jackson Eshbaugh
Jackson Eshbaugh is on page 35 of 750
The other day, I revised my lexer to take in a few more symbols (namely ~ and -) in preparation for adding unary operators. Well, now, I finished updating my parser, and the AST structure has been updated to include these. Next up, I'll be diving into TACKY as an intermediate to represent Assembly. Super excited!
Jul 04, 2025 07:17PM
Writing a C Compiler: Build a Real Programming Language from Scratch


Jackson Eshbaugh
Jackson Eshbaugh is on page 25 of 750
Jul 01, 2025 07:48PM
Writing a C Compiler: Build a Real Programming Language from Scratch


Jackson Eshbaugh
Jackson Eshbaugh is on page 17 of 750
Just wrote the parser today! Super useful tips and explanation!
Jun 30, 2025 07:11PM
Writing a C Compiler: Build a Real Programming Language from Scratch


No comments have been added yet.